Understanding the Aviator Game Mechanics
At its core, the aviator game is remarkably straightforward. A plane takes off on the screen, and as it ascends, a multiplier increases. The player’s objective is to cash out their bet before the plane flies away. The longer the plane remains in flight, the higher the multiplier – and thus, the greater the potential winnings. However, there’s a catch: the plane can disappear at any moment, resulting in a loss of the entire stake. This balance between risk and reward is what makes the game so addictive and engaging.
The random number generator (RNG) at the heart of the game ensures fairness, determining the exact point at which the plane will take off. There’s no predictable pattern; each round is independent of the last. This consistent randomness prevents any form of manipulation and guarantees a level playing field for all players. Bankroll Management and Responsible Gaming
Effective bankroll management is paramount when playing the aviator game. It’s crucial to establish a budget and stick to it, regardless of wins or losses. A common rule of thumb is to only bet a small percentage of your total bankroll on each round – typically between 1% and 5%. This approach helps to weather potential losing streaks without depleting your funds. Avoiding impulsive bets and resisting the urge to chase losses are equally important.
Responsible gaming involves setting time limits, taking regular breaks, and recognizing the signs of problematic gambling behavior. If you are no longer seeing the game as entertainment and it is affecting your finances, relationships, or mental health, it’s important to seek help. Many resources are available to provide support and guidance, encouraging a healthy and balanced approach to online gaming. Remember, the goal is to enjoy the experience responsibly, not to rely on it for financial gain.
